WebAn adult wolf’s typical paw print is 8 to 10 centimetres long. The animal’s claws are clearly visible, and this enables the tracks of a wolf to be distinguished from those of a lynx, for example. Unlike felines, wolves cannot retract their claws. Wolves can live to a similar age as dogs - around 10 to 12 years.

WebOct 15, 2024 · Black wolves are so colored because of a genetic mutation in their K locus gene.
